Summary     : Install a running LiveOS rebootlessly
Description :
This installer will perfrom a traditional LiveOS installation,
however instead of installing a fresh copy of the LiveOS to
disk to be used on the next reboot, it live migrates the running
LiveOS's root filesystem to disk.  In this fashion it does not
require a reboot to begin using the installed system.

Update Information:

This is a bugfix release of zyx-liveinstaller, which fixes the following issues:
* cli: fix /boot partition boot and type flags not being set    - thanks to
feedback from Tom Gilliard  * cli: move to a consistent bash quoting style  *
gui: correctly narrow check for f11 seperate /boot requirement  * gui: correctly
disallow /boot on lvm  * gui: use /etc/zyx-liveinstaller.install.txt if
available  * gui: abort after intro if already installed, with error page
